Giant's Tank Sanctuary is a wildlife sanctuary located in northern Sri Lanka, about 20 km southeast of Mannar. Established in 1954, it covers an area of 43 square kilometers and is home to a variety of flora and fauna, including water and wader birds, fish species, and Asian elephants. Unfortunately, the sanctuary has faced challenges like illegal deforestation for banana plantations.
